Hare Krishna! You are our heroes, the heroes of Bhaktivedanta Manor. We are so proud of you and grateful to you for putting yourselves out there, braving not only the elements—the cold, the rain, the wind—but even more, opening yourselves to be humiliated by the people to whom you’re offering the highest gift. What you’re doing is called seva, divine selfless service. It’s extremely rare and extremely precious. And in this mad world, the gift you’re giving, the gift of Krishna consciousness, is extremely needed.

More than ever, the people of this world need Srila Prabhupada’s teachings. His words and example have helped each one of us, saving us from a life of frustration, improving every aspect of our existence, and giving us true values, direction and hope – and Prabhupada’s teachings can similarly help everyone else. The spreading of Krishna consciousness is the supreme welfare activity.

Please carry on distributing books with full hearted enthusiasm, knowing that the sacred service you’re doing is the desire of Srila Prabhupada and Sri Sri Radha Gokulananda. The Bhagavatam declares, “when one performs benevolent activities for others, the Supreme Personality of Godhead is pleased.” The Lord very quickly recognises such service performed by His devotee. And if the Lord and this representative are pleased, what is there left to achieve?
